In Kyiv, the head of the Information and Educational Department of the UOC led a memorial litia for monk Varsonofiy.

On August 24, 2026, Metropolitan Kliment of Nizhyn and Pryluky led a memorial litia for the newly departed monastic of the Svyatohorsk Lavra, monk Varsonofiy (Turyansky), at the Academic Church of Venerable John of Damascus at the Pokrovsky Monastery in Kyiv. This was reported by the press service of the KThAaS.

Metropolitan Kliment, who heads the Educational Committee under the Holy Synod of the UOC, was co-served at the divine service by faculty members and students of the Kyiv Theological Academy and Seminary in holy orders. Faculty members, students and pupils of the Kyiv Theological Schools, parishioners of the Academic Church and pilgrims of the Pokrovsky Monastery also prayed at the litia.

During the divine service, prayers were offered for the repose of the soul of monk Varsonofiy, who died on August 23, 2026, as a result of an attack on the monastics of the Svyatohorsk Lavra.

As the UOJ reported, a monk was brutally murdered at the Svyatohorsk Lavra and two more monastics were wounded.
